Description

2,1-Benzisothiazole-3-Carbonyl Chloride (9Ci) is a high-purity, reactive chemical intermediate characterized by its acid chloride functionality. This compound is a critical building block in advanced organic synthesis, enabling the efficient introduction of the benzisothiazole pharmacophore. It is primarily utilized by research institutions and manufacturers in the pharmaceutical and agrochemical industries for the development of novel active ingredients and fine chemicals.

Basic Information

Product Name 2,1-Benzisothiazole-3-Carbonyl Chloride (9Ci)
CAS No. 57676-11-6
Molecular Formula C8H4ClNOS
Molecular Weight 197.64 g/mol
Synonyms 2,1-Benzisothiazole-3-carbonyl chloride; 1,2-Benzisothiazole-3-carbonyl chloride; 3-Chlorocarbonyl-1,2-benzisothiazole; Benzisothiazole-3-carbonyl chloride; 2,1-Benzisothiazol-3-yl carbonyl chloride; 1,2-Benzisothiazol-3-carbonyl chloride; 3-(Chlorocarbonyl)-1,2-benzisothiazole

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ic and moisture-sensitive n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ent decomposition. Keep away from strong acids and incompatible organic solvents.
